Name:Hut in settlement south-west of Deadlake Foot, Peter Tavy

Summary

Hut circle 3.0m in internal diameter and levelled into the slope with a low stone and boulder bank but no visible entrance in settlement north-west of junction of the Rattle Brook and the River Tavy recorded in 1992 and 1998.

Full description

Gerrard, S., 1990-2002, Monument Protection Programme. Archaeological Item Dataset., MPP 130619 (Report - Survey). SDV277946.

Visited in 1992. SX 5590 8384 Hut circle surviving as earthwork terraced into the hillslope. Simple plan type. The interior measures 2.3 metres in diameter and is defined by a 1 metre wide wall standing up to 0.3 metres high. Fragments of rubble walling have been identified to the south of this hut, although it is not clear whether these represent field-plots or an enclosure boundary.

Butler, J., 1991, Dartmoor Atlas of Antiquities: Volume Two - The North, 104, Map 32, Site 9 (Monograph). SDV219155.

Hut circle at 'Rattlebrook Foot' settlement.

Probert, S. + Fletcher, M. + Newman, P., 1998, Willsworthy Training Area, Peter Tavy, Devon: An Archaeological survey by the Royal Commission on the Historical Monuments of England (Report - Survey). SDV350638.

(25/06/1998) Two groups of prehistoric hut circles and associated walling lie on a SE-facing hillslope. Centred at SX55908384 and SX55748388 respectively they lie in an area of extensive, relatively modern peat cutting between 440m and 455m above OD.
(Eastern settlement; middle hut) SX55908384 3.0m in internal diameter and levelled into the slope with a low stone and boulder bank but no visible entrance.
The low boulder stone walling which is visible in the peat cutting area is probably part of a field system which is covered elsewhere by the deep peat layer and purple moorgrass.

Environment Agency WMS, 2022, Environment Agency LIDAR Composite DTM 2022 - 1m (Cartographic). SDV365447.

Faintly visible on the lidar data at the map location given by the 1998 survey.
